Enhancing intraocular lens outcome precision: an evaluation of axial length determinations, keratometry, and IOL formulas.
Accurate biometry and intraocular lens (IOL) calculations have consequence in patient satisfaction and depend on correct determination of eye length, IOL position, refractive power of the cornea, and selection of the proper IOL formula. Familiarity with these variables will make it easier to achieve precise results in both the intact eyes and eyes that have had previous surgeries, including keratorefractive procedures. This articles provide practical tips and methods to avoid refractive surprises.
